Grant Overview
Comprehensive Data Collection for Pediatric Oral Health in Utah
In Utah, the pediatric population faces specific oral health challenges that necessitate targeted data collection efforts. Recent studies indicate that an alarming 25% of children in Utah have untreated dental issues, with disparities evident between urban and rural areas. Lack of comprehensive data hinders the ability of healthcare providers and policymakers to adequately address these disparities. To effectively improve children's dental health in the state, establishing robust data systems is essential to identify trends and inform resource allocation.
Who Should Apply in Utah?
Eligible organizations include public health agencies, academic institutions, and non-profit entities that focus on health data collection and analysis. Applicants must demonstrate existing capabilities in data management and a commitment to addressing pediatric oral health issues. Collaborative proposals that involve partnerships with local health departments and dental care providers are strongly encouraged, as they foster a more comprehensive understanding of health needs.
Application Requirements
Organizations planning to apply will need to submit proposals detailing their methodologies for data collection, analysis, and reporting. A clear plan for engaging with communities and stakeholders to gather qualitative and quantitative data will be crucial. Applicants will also need to outline how their proposed initiatives will directly impact pediatric oral health outcomes in Utah and align with state health priorities.
Why This Funding Matters in Utah
This initiative aims to fill critical information gaps regarding pediatric dental health, allowing Utah to develop targeted interventions. Effective data collection will empower stakeholders to design strategies that specifically address the unique needs of children across the state. By understanding the dental health landscape, Utah can invest resources strategically, ultimately leading to improved health outcomes and reduced disparities among children.
Implementation Approach
Implementation includes establishing partnerships with healthcare providers and schools to facilitate data collection processes. Organizations will utilize both electronic health records and community surveys to gather data comprehensively. Continuous feedback mechanisms will be built into the data collection process to ensure that the information captured is reflective of the actual needs within the communities served, enabling Utah to respond dynamically to pediatric oral health challenges.
